About the event

De-Con/Re-Con Hour: Deconstructing & Reconstructing Faith
De-Con/Re-Con is a safe space for talking through the Deconstruction and/or Reconstruction of our Faith. Father Ryan will be available in the Nave to listen and explore together with all participants as we deconstruct old assumptions, "high-control" religious upbringing, purity culture, shame syndromes, spiritual abuse, and our journey to find healing.

In addition to deconstruction and healing, we may also feel drawn to reconstructing our faith, sometimes in the same tradition as before, and sometimes in an entirely new tradition. This is part of the Decon/Recon journey that we travel together, if so desired.

Disclaimers:

1. Although the program is held at St. Michael's Episcopal Church, it is not designed to promote one parish, one denomination, or one religion. It is designed to help everyone heal from past hurts and find the path that is most life-giving for them.

2. The program is led by The Rev. Ryan Wiksell, parish priest at St. Michael's. Ryan is not a licensed therapist or spiritual director. He is an ordained Episcopal priest with experience in a variety of denominational traditions and spiritual expressions.

3. It is not our intention to denigrate or oppose any denomination, congregation or faith tradition. However, participants may express personal concerns about their religious experience or upbringing, which we will explore together. In the process, toxic patterns may be revealed which will be addressed as such, with honesty and authenticity, but without judgment toward the source of such patterns.

4. If issues come to light which require professional therapy, a referral may be made. No one present will attempt to offer such treatment.
